SAFETY PROTOCOL SOLUTION

😊

Proper safety steps to take BEFORE servicing high voltage equipment:

  1. De-energize the equipment and lockout/tagout (LOTO)
  2. Test for zero energy with a verified voltage tester
  3. Establish restricted approach boundaries
  4. Wear appropriate PPE (insulated gloves, face shield, etc.)
  5. Have a qualified observer present
  6. Follow company-specific safety procedures
